Description
- jadeite
each of flattened baluster form, with a central archaistic monster-mask and loose-ring handle above the foot, the sides flanked by two chilong clambering over angular scrollwork, the cover surmounted by a lion finial, the opaque-green stone with russet inclusions, supported on a carved openwork wood stand above a gilt metal waisted rectangular plinth cast with foliate decoration centered by a stylized shou character, the vases surmounted with flared kesi-fragment lampshade and fruit-form jadeite finial (7)
Condition
Both jadeite lamps are attached to the metal mounts so the bases cannot be inspected. One lamp with a polished down inclusion to the tip of one tail of a Chilong. The other lamp has a tiny chip to the ear of one Chilong and a small nick to the corner of one cover. A carved inclusion runs across the top of one of the finials. One cover is glued to the metal mounts, the other is detached. The wire inlaid wood bases have some small nicks and areas where the wire is lifting. The metal is tarnished, worn in areas and one lamp has some pale green patination near the top of the base. The jadeite, wire-inlaid and metal bases of both lamps have age appropriate wear over the surface
